Colour print portrait showing Ellen Terry as Beatrice and Henry Irving as Benedick in a production of Much Ado About Nothing, at the Lyceum Theatre, October 1882
Much Ado About Nothing is one of William Shakespeare's comedies. The production at the Lyceum Theatre was produced and directed by Henry Irving, who played Benedick, and the cast also included Ellen Terry as Beatrice and Johnston Forbes-Robertson as Claudio.

Physical description | Colour print portrait showing Ellen Terry and Henry Irving in a production of Much Ado About Nothing, at the Lyceum Theatre, October 1882. The print shows Ellen Terry as Beatrice and Henry Irving as Benedick. Terrry is wearing a yellow dress with a white collar, puffed sleeves and a white belt tied in the middle and hanging downwards. She has her hair tied up and is reaching with her left hand to hold Irving's. Irving has brown hair and a moustache. He is wearing a light blue tunic and tights with a yellow overtunic that has a white lining and trimming. He has brown gloves and is holding Terry's hand with his left hand. There is a sword behind his back, and he has his head turned towards Terry. |
